תוֹכֶן
ההבדל העיקרי
גם G-WAN (freeware) וגם Nginx (קוד פתוח) הם שרתי HTTP עבור לינוקס ו- Windows. שניהם מתכוונים להיות "קלים" ו"מהירים ". פרויקט Nginx החל בשנת 2004 ואילו G-WAN החל בשנת 2009. G-WAN פועל כתהליך יחיד עם חוט לכל מעבד פיזי (או Core). Nginx פועל כתהליך אב וכמה תהליכי עובדים. הגיל של Nginx פחות גמיש בהשוואה ל- G-Wan.
מה זה G-WAN?
G-WAN מריץ C, C # או Java עם פחות מעבד ופחות זיכרון RAM תוך כדי טיפול בבקשות רבות יותר משרתים אחרים. שפות אחרות (Go, PHP, Python, Ruby, JS ...) נהנות מהארכיטקטורה הרב-ליבתית של G-WAN. G-WAN תומך ב- HTTP 1.1, אך מטפלי הפרוטוקולים שלו גמישים יותר ומקלים על חיבור ספריות צד ג ', מספר גדול יותר של פרוטוקולים יושמו, כגון SCGI, DNS (TCP ו- UDP), SMTP ו- POP3, מספר שרתי בסיסי נתונים ומפתחות / ערך, ואפילו VPN.
מה זה נגינקס?
NGINX הוא הלב הסודי של הרשת המודרנית, המפעילה 1 מכל 3 מהאתרים והיישומים העמוסים ביותר בעולם. פרויקט הקוד הפתוח של NGINX החל בשנת 2002 וצמח באופן אקספוננציאלי במהלך 10 השנים האחרונות. כיום מיליוני מחדשים בוחרים ב- NGINX לצורך אספקת האתרים והיישומים שלהם עם ביצועים, אמינות, אבטחה וקנה מידה.
הבדלים עיקריים
- G-WAN פועל כתהליך יחיד עם חוט לכל מעבד פיזי (או Core). Nginx פועל כתהליך אב וכמה תהליכי עובדים.
- שיתוף השווקים של G-WAN אינו ידוע אך ככל הנראה הרבה מתחת ל -1%, התואם את השוק של Nginx באותו גיל (אתר האינטרנט והתיעוד Nginx תורגמו לאחר 5 שנות שימוש "סודי" מוגבל לשוק הרוסי).
- G-WAN שואפת להיות סופר-מהיר ללא תצורה, תוך הצעת סקריפטים של "עריכה והפעלה" ב- Asm, C, C ++, C #, D, Go, Java, JavaScript, Lua, Objective-C, Perl, PHP, Python, Ruby וסקאלה (וחנות Key-Value, לקוח, קלט / פלט GIF, רישום דו מימדי, תרשימים וקונצרטים, קריפטו, RNGs ...) שאולי נראים מעט מכוונים למפתחים עבור מעצבי אתרים אך אשר ישמח את המתכנתים - הקהל ממוקד לעומת זאת, ל- Nginx תכונות רבות של שרת אינטרנט מסורתי (כמו סוגים שונים של קבצי תצורה ומודולים מורכבים) אשר ממקדים יותר את Masters Web מאשר מפתחי רשת.
- Nginx תומך ב- HTTP 1.1 ו- SPDY ובביצוע טיוטת HTTP 2.0 באמצעות מודולים ספציפיים ל- Nginx.
- G-WAN תומך גם ב- HTTP 1.1, אך מטפלי הפרוטוקולים שלו גמישים יותר ומקלים הרבה על חיבור ספריות צד ג ', יושמו מספר גדול יותר של פרוטוקולים, כמו SCGI, DNS (TCP ו- UDP), SMTP ו- POP3 , מספר שרתי מסדי נתונים ומפתחות / ערך ואפילו VPN.
- נגינקס, למרות גילה פחות גמיש בהשוואה ל- G-Wan.
- Nginx, המבוגרת פי שניים מ- G-WAN, הגדילה את מניות השווקים שלה במהירות לאחר שמייסד DELL מחשבים השקיע בחברה המסחרית "Nginx Inc". בעוד שהסטטיסטיקה שונה בהתאם לחברות המודדות את מניות השווקים, Nginx משמשת כיום בכ 37.7% מהאתרים על פי סקר שרת האינטרנט באפריל 2014.
- באמצעות עיצוב שונה המבוסס על חוטים ואירועים, G-WAN הוא קל ומהיר יותר משרתי המיינסטרים, עובדה המאומתת באופן עצמאי על ידי כמה מדדי צד שלישי לאורך השנים.